Jacob Dickert, of Lancaster county, Pennsylvania, was a highly accomplished gun maker circa 1755-1822. He made his own lock for the guns he built and also built locks for other gun builders. The Allentown-Bethlehem, Lancaster and Bucks County schools and makers within these schools such as A. Verner, J. Moll, John Rupp, John Knoll, Fordney, Schweitzer and J.P. Beck utilized this style lock.
Features traditional hook type springs, bearing surfaces on tumbler and sear, water resistant pan, cam action, forged mainspring and highly polished internals. Plate measures 5-3/8" x 15/16". Right hand. No. 43008
